I have been a steady customer of the Rio Mirage in both Surprise and El Mirage locations for several years. I am familiar with some of the staff. Stephanie is the manger of both locations. She is very friendly, approachable and is always on top of making sure the restaurant customers needs are met. The servers staff that I am familiar with include Raudel, Reyna, and of course Gladis who always remembers to bring some Habanero (HOT) salsa with the regular salsa and chips. The lunch menu variety is great. For $10, you can have an excellent meal if you are there between 11:00AM and 2:00PM. I usually have the Flautas in chicken or beef for lunch. When I am really hungry, I order the Bombero dinner which is a tender marinated inside skirt steak in thick slices, sauteed and simmered with onions, tomatoes, and bell peppers in our special spices, topped with our very spicy hot green sauce. Served with rice, beans and fresh hot tortillas. Oh my, what a meal! I usually end up taking half the plate home as it is a lot of food! I have also tried the Chicken Fajitas plate which is good but my favorite plate is the Bombero dinner. I am a regular customer and can found there at least once a week or even more when...

This place is exactly the type of Mexican Restaurant that I always look for yet seem not to find nearly enough. The old school Mexican Cafe vibe is perfect. The dining room is welcoming, vibrant and festive, yet pleasantly dark and shady at the same time and it serves as an oasis to the Phoenix heat and sprawl just outside. I kept it relatively basic on this my first visit with the combination of 2 shredded beef tacos and a cheese enchilada with beans and rice and I was not disappointed. Piping hot and infinitely flavorful I didn’t stop until every morsel was gone and I cannot wait to come back and try one of their signature burritos or something else. Before I left I was offered a fresh tortilla by the manager, Valerie made onsite just earlier and needless to say, Rio Mirage has a customer for life! I highly recommend!

Beautifully decorated inside with an authentic and rustic look. Beautiful patio area with twinkle lights. The lights inside created a nice ambiance and would be a nice date night atmosphere or family dining. The house Margarita on the rocks was good. My dinner was amazing . I took a photo of what I ordered, it was the Pollo con Verduras 19.25/+ Perfectly char-grilled chicken, zucchini, bell peppers, onions, mushrooms, and tomatoes cooked al dente topped with cheese and slices of Avocado and your choice of one side black beans, refried beans, or rice | Camarones available for $23 I ordered a desert to go, and even tho the kitchen had closed unbeknownst to me they were kind enough to make my desert of Churros with a side of Fried Ice Cream. Everything was delicious!
